  • The tale of making the Witcher Steel Sword from the Netflix show out of meteorite. From the forging of the blade to the creation of Renfri's broach, we show it all. A sword Geralt of Rivia would be proud to use. This sword is featured in Witcher season one and Witcher season 2 on Netflix. The tale is told by our very own bard, Chris Cash of Mt Phillip Metal Works.
    Working with meteorite is complex in it’s self. Making a sword of this quality adds several challenges. Not only working the material but heat treating the blade and grinding the complex plunges and creating the proper garnishments using classical silversmithing techniques. Gem setting, chasing and repousse are all used to bring this magical sword to life.
